Subject: Re: [PATCH] sched/fair: Care divide error in update_task_scan_period()

On Wed, Oct 08, 2014 at 12:42:24PM -0400, Rik van Riel wrote:
> On 10/08/2014 02:43 AM, Yasuaki Ishimatsu wrote:
>
> > The divide error is rare case because the trigger is node offline.
> > By this patch, when both of private and shared are set to 0, diff
> > is just set to 0, not calculating the division.
>
> How about a simple
>
> if (private + shared) == 0)
> return;
>
> higher up in the function, to avoid adding an extra
> layer of indentation and confusion to the main part
> of the function?
At which point we'll have 3 different return semantics. Should we not
clear numa_faults_localityp[], even in this case?
